I’m retired law enforcement from Tampa Florida. I’ve owned this property since 2008. My original cabin burned down to the ground in the November 2016 wildfires along with many others. I survived the fire because I was in Florida at the time where my home there had been flooded by hurricane Hermine. I was ripping out walls and cabinets and throwing out furniture when I got the news of the fire here. It’s taken 3 years to rebuild back because of lack of skilled construction labor along with so many others rebuilding. I’m good now and I hope you enjoy the fruits of my labor.
